Transaction 25880bc714255741d24688c31b9e82a75098d2939ef2120fc26649707a590205

2 Input
2 Outputs
  • 25880bc714255741d24688c31b9e82a75098d2939ef2120fc26649707a590205:0
  • value  516442875
    address  1MZZBe5jTT9Y6No6BFzNANnS2ENtuXEfxh
  • 25880bc714255741d24688c31b9e82a75098d2939ef2120fc26649707a590205:1
  • value  483551141
    address  1JkzGJ58qAEyPYYMAZZM7TyzbFzeW825fs